What are the Prevailing Trends in Worldwide Threat Intelligence Environments?
In the global threat intelligence landscape, there has been a noticeable shift towards the integration of artificial intelligence (AI) and machine learning (ML) methodologies. These technologies have enhanced the ability to predict, detect, and resolve cyber threats, subsequently fortifying organizational cyber defenses. Furthermore, companies are now leaning towards customized, industry-specific threat intelligence platforms to improve their contextual understanding of potential threats.
How are Collaborative Frameworks Influencing these Platforms?
Another prominent trend is the increased collaboration between organizations, cybersecurity vendors, and governmental agencies. This trend facilitates a comprehensive sharing of cyber threat intelligence, enriching the overall quality of data and analysis. It has also led to the rise of open-source intelligence platforms that aggregate data from diverse sources, providing comprehensive and up-to-the-minute threat analysis.
What Shifts are Expected in the Use of Threat Intelligence Platforms?
In the future, the usage of threat intelligence platforms is expected to shift from being a predominantly large-enterprise solution to one that caters to smaller businesses. This shift stems from an increased realization of the cyber threats facing small and medium businesses. Additionally, the move towards Threat Intelligence as a Service is expected to accelerate, providing organizations a cost-effective way to enhance their cybersecurity postures.
